Players and regulators are converging on tougher transparency around generative AI and monetization, from Brazil's 18-plus rating for Mario Kart Tour to accusations of undisclosed AI assets in Crimson Desert. At the same time, demand remains robust, with Crimson Desert surpassing two million sales and a community analysis estimating $92 million in Steam revenue for Slay the Spire 2, underscoring that clear value propositions still cut through. These signals suggest rising compliance and disclosure expectations even as the market rewards multiplayer features, polished updates, and fair pricing.
